SUNNYVALE, Calif., May 15,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Cerebras Systems Inc. (“Cerebras”) today announced the closing of its initial public offering of an aggregate of 34,500,000 shares of its Class A common stock, at a public offering price of $185.00 per share, which included the exercise in full by the underwriters of their option to purchase up to an additional 4,500,000 shares of its Class A common stock at the initial public offering price, less underwriting discounts and commissions. The aggregate gross proceeds from the offering, before deducting underwriting discounts and commissions and other offering expenses, was approximately $6.38 billion.

Cerebras’s Class A common stock began trading on the Nasdaq Global Select Market on May 14, 2026, under the ticker symbol “CBRS.”

Morgan Stanley, Citigroup, Barclays, and UBS Investment Bank acted as lead book-running managers for the offering. Mizuho and TD Cowen acted as bookrunners. Needham & Company, Craig-Hallum, Wedbush Securities, Rosenblatt, Academy Securities, Credit Agricole CIB, MUFG, and First Citizens Capital Securities acted as co-managers. 

A registration statement relating to these securities was declared effective by the Securities and Exchange Commission on May 13, 2025. About Cerebras Systems

Cerebras Systems (NASDAQ: CBRS) is building the fastest AI infrastructure in the world. We are a team of pioneering computer architects, computer scientists, AI researchers, and engineers of all types. We have come together to make AI blisteringly fast through innovation and invention because we believe that when AI is fast, it will change the world. Our flagship technology, the Wafer-Scale Engine 3 (WSE-3) is the world’s largest and fastest commercialized AI processor. 58 times larger than a leading GPU chip, the WSE-3 uses a fraction of the power per unit compute while delivering inference up to 15 times faster than leading GPU-based solutions as benchmarked on leading open-source models. Leading corporations, research institutes, and governments on four continents chose Cerebras to run their AI workloads. Cerebras solutions are available on premises and in the cloud.
